[PATCH 3/3] userfaultfd: selftest: vm: allow to build in vm/ directory

linux/tools/testing/selftests/vm $ make
gcc -Wall -I ../../../../usr/include     compaction_test.c -lrt -o /compaction_test
/usr/lib/gcc/x86_64-pc-linux-gnu/4.9.4/../../../../x86_64-pc-linux-gnu/bin/ld:
cannot open output file /compaction_test: Permission denied
collect2: error: ld returned 1 exit status
make: *** [../lib.mk:54: /compaction_test] Error 1

Since commit a8ba798bc8ec663cf02e80b0dd770324de9bafd9 selftests/vm
build fails if run from the "selftests/vm" directory, but it works in
the selftests/ directory. It's quicker to be able to do a local
vm-only build after a tree wipe and this patch allows for it again.

 tools/testing/selftests/vm/Makefile | 4 ++++
 1 file changed, 4 insertions(+)

diff --git a/tools/testing/selftests/vm/Makefile b/tools/testing/selftests/vm/Makefile
index 4cff7e7..41642ba 100644
--- a/tools/testing/selftests/vm/Makefile
+++ b/tools/testing/selftests/vm/Makefile
@@ -1,5 +1,9 @@
 # Makefile for vm selftests
 
+ifndef OUTPUT
+  OUTPUT := $(shell pwd)
+endif
+
 CFLAGS = -Wall -I ../../../../usr/include $(EXTRA_CFLAGS)
 LDLIBS = -lrt
 TEST_GEN_FILES = compaction_test
